Ghana Foresees a Cashless Economy with its New CBDC Pilot Program

The Bank of Ghana is teaming up with Giesecke+Devrient (G+D) to launch a Central Bank Digital Currency pilot program. This move could make Ghana the first African country to unleash its digital currency.  According to a press release, the collaborative effort will test the issuance of a general-purpose CBDC dubbed as Cedi through various stakeholders, including banks, consumers, merchants, payment providers, and many more.
